Fun gift.......turned sour......turned fun once more!

Many, many years ago, my Aunt gave us a wonderful gift for Christmas.  Everyone in the family loved the gift and thought it was the greatest thing since sliced bread, especially the small elementary aged children..........until we heard this for hours on end.......

yes, I know it is sideways, but couldn't figure out how to change it...



Did I mention there were elementary aged kids involved?  I'm sure you can imagine how many times....per minute...that we heard this at full volume!!!!!  

It wasn't long before I hated greatly disliked this gift!  

In Indiana, it got banned to the basement and the "kids area" of the house.  But then we moved to Arkansas.  Last Christmas, as I was taking out my decorations, I saw this santa and discretely left it in the box and put it back in the closet. 

 However, it wasn't long before a teenage boy realized it was missing and went looking for it.  Said boy realized that his mom had left it packed away on purpose and decided to place it in a very prominent place in the house.....for all to see and hear

Well, I was not deterred.  While said boy was in school, I hid the Santa in his room knowing that it would not be found among the junk clutter in his room.  Unfortunately, said boy is much more aware of what is in his room than I thought, found the Santa and hid it among MY junk in my room......I am not so aware and it took me a while to discover him!

And so began a war of hiding the Santa for the other one that lasted until it was time to put the decorations away.  

This year, some one found the Santa right off and put it on the table.  My son didn't say a word about hiding it again this year.  So, before I left for Florida, I hid it in a very secretive spot in his room.  With all that happened with my aunt, I forgot about the Santa completely.  Well, Sunday as I was searching for something I could wear to church, I pushed aside some clothes and found this....



On a closer look, can you read the note?

It says............. "Let the games begin!"   

And so begins a new tradition in the Bowyer house!!!
